Day 1c of the 888Live London Festival is set to be a busy one.
There is a Turbo Satellite to the Opening Event starting at 12 p.m. with Day 1c starting at 2 p.m.
The final chance to make Day 2 is the 6 p.m. Turbo Day 1d.
The £220 buy-in £120,000 guaranteed Opening Event is the first of a series of events over the next 10 days with satellites and tournaments to suit everyone. You can find the full list of scheduled events here.
Day 1a on Thursday saw Jamie Spencer endeding up as the runaway chip leader bagging 1,083,000. He came out on top of 182 entries with 21 making it through to Day 2.
Vincent Anderson was the Day 1b chip leader with 775,000 from 246 entries and 39 players made it through.

The shuffle up and deal has been issued and play is under way.
They are all set for 13 levels of play today with 6 30-minute levels and 7 40-minute levels.
Players are allowed 2 re-entries is they choose.
Over 100 entries already so far in what is a relatively early start for some poker players but perfect for the more recreational players with close of play due around 11 p.m. tonight and the final day due to end on Sunday.

There are 130 entries so far and a few bust outs already, but players can re-enter two times if they wish.
Late registration is open all day to the end of the 13 levels so numbers will steadily rise throughout the day, indeed there is still a queue of eager players at the registration desk.
With 182 entries from Day 1a and 246 from Day 1b and a Day 1d Turbo schedule for this evening the Opening Event of the 888Live London festival at Aspers is off to a tremendous start.
